2-(4-chlorophenyl)-2-hydroxyacetonitrile
Also Known As: p-chloromandelonitrile, 4-Chlorophenylhydroxyacetonitrile, (R)-(+)-4-Chloromandelonitrile, Hydroxy 4-chlorophenylacetonitrile, 2-(4-chlorophenyl)-2-hydroxyacetonitrile
| Molecular Formula | C8H6ClNO |
| Molecular Weight | 167.0138 g/mol |
| XLogP | 1.7 |
| Topological Polar Surface Area (TPSA) | 44.0 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 1 |
| Exact Mass | 167.0138 Da |
| Heavy Atoms | 11 |
| Complexity | 166.0 |
| SMILES | C1=CC(=CC=C1C(C#N)O)Cl |
| InChIKey | LSDSHEPNJSMUTI-UHFFFAOYSA-N |
The XLogP value of 1.7 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 2-(4-Chlorophenyl)-2-hydroxyacetonitrile. With a topological polar surface area (TPSA) of 44.0 Ų, 2-(4-Chlorophenyl)-2-hydroxyacetonitrile ex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 2-(4-Chlorophenyl)-2-hydroxyacetonitrile has 1 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
